With zsh 5.0.2, if I run "zsh -f" and type

SAVEHIST=8000
HISTFILE="$HOME/.zhistory.tmp"

in the shell, then commands, and I quit with Ctrl-D, the history
is not saved. Ditto with:

  SAVEHIST=8000 HISTFILE="$HOME/.zhistory.tmp" zsh -f

This problem doesn't occur if I don't use the "-f" option, after
removing all my ~/.z* startup files.

I was a bit tired when i sent that reply, guess i could have been a
tad more informative :).

   Note also that the RCS option affects the saving of
   history files, i.e. if RCS is unset when the shell
   exits, no history file will be saved.
...
    -f     NO_RCS

The entry in zshoptions for RCS should probably mention this as well.

Thanks. I sugggest that the man pages be changed to be more informative:

   HISTFILE
      The file to save the history in when an interactive shell exits
      (unless the RCS option is unset, as with the `-f' option).  If
      HISTFILE is unset, the history is not saved.
